Side-by-side financial comparison of Amgen (AMGN) and Parker Hannifin (PH).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Amgen is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($8.6B vs $6.2B, roughly 1.4× Parker Hannifin). Amgen runs the higher net margin — 21.1% vs 14.6%, a 6.5%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Parker Hannifin pos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(10.6% vs 5.8%). Over the past eight quarters, Parker Hannifin's revenue compounded faster (9.1% CAGR vs 1.4%).

Amgen Inc. is an American multinational biopharmaceutical company headquartered in Thousand Oaks, California. The company is ranked 18th on the list of largest biomedical companies by revenue. The name "AMGen" is a portmanteau of the company's original name, Applied Molecular Genetics.

Parker-Hannifin Corporation, originally Parker Appliance Company, usually referred to as just Parker, is an American corporation specializing in motion and control technologies. Its corporate headquarters are in Mayfield Heights, Ohio, in Greater Cleveland.
